Key Notes

    Lokkhi Puja Muhurta

    • Date: Lakshmi Puja will be on October 6, 2025.
    • Tithi: It falls on Purnima (Full Moon), from 12:24 PM (Oct 6) to 9:17 AM (Oct 7).
    • Nakshatra: Uttara Bhadrapada (Oct 6, 6:16 AM to Oct 7, 4:01 AM), then Revati begins.
    • Best Time: Midnight (Nishita Kaal) is most auspicious.
    • Main Items: Clay idol, kalash (holy pot), rice, diya (lamp), and flowers.
    • Rituals: Alpana (rangoli), aarti with dhoop/camphor, and sapta tari (banana boat).

Lakshmi Puja will happen on 6 October 2025. The tithi will be Purnima. It will begin at 12.24 PM on 6 October. It will end at 9.17 AM on 7 October. The tithi before this was Chaturdashi. That started on 5 October at 3.04 PM. On 6 October the nakshatra will be Uttara Bhadrapada. It will start at 6.16 AM. It will continue till 4.01 AM on 7 October. After that, Revati nakshatra will begin. Revati will run into the next day.

Lakshmi Puja

Lakshmi Puja is a Hindu festival. People worship Goddess Lakshmi on this day. She brings wealth and prosperity. This puja happens after Durga Puja in Bengal. In Bengal, Odisha, and Assam, people celebrate it differently. They do it on Amavasya night. North India does it later. The best time is midnight.
